Sound and animation also contribute to the digital experience. These elements can make games feel lively, but they should remain separate from expectations about outcomes.
A colorful animation does not indicate that a winning result is approaching. Likewise, an exciting sound effect cannot predict what will happen during the next round.
This distinction is especially important because digital entertainment can be highly engaging. Games are designed to hold attention, so players should establish their own boundaries before beginning.
A spending budget is one of the simplest boundaries. Players should decide how much money they are comfortable using for entertainment and avoid adding more simply because a session is not going as expected.
Time limits are equally useful. Digital platforms are available almost continuously, and mobile devices make it easy to start another session. A predetermined stopping time can help keep gaming within reasonable limits.
Breaks provide another layer of control. Stepping away from a screen gives players time to relax and consider whether continuing is still appropriate.
Promotions are also a major part of online entertainment. Bonuses, free spins, loyalty rewards, and other offers can make platforms more engaging. However, players should read the conditions before accepting any promotion.
Different offers can have different requirements, including wagering conditions, eligible games, and expiration periods.
